El Banco
El Banco is a locality in Reynosa, Tamaulipas. El Banco is situated nearby to the locality Arnoldo García Olivares, as well as near Nuevo Amanecer.Places of Interest

Reynosa-Pharr International Bridge
Bridge
The Pharr–Reynosa International Bridge is an international bridge across the Rio Grande, along the U.S.–Mexico border. It connects the city of Pharr in the U.S. state of Texas with the city of Reynosa in the Mexican state of Tamaulipas. Reynosa-Pharr International Bridge is situated 3½ km east of El Banco.

Hidalgo
Town
Hidalgo is a city in Hidalgo County, Texas, United States. Its population was 11,198 at the 2010 census, and in 2020, the population had risen to 13,964. Hidalgo is situated 4½ km north of El Banco.
